Sleep

Vue- Incentives - Vue.js Nourished #.\n\nVue-rewards permits you add micro-interactions to your Vue 3 application, and also rewards users along with the rain of confetti, emoji or balloons in seconds.\n\nVue 3 only. Not compatible with Vue 2.\nThis deal is actually a port of react-rewards.\nTrial.\nListed here is actually a straightforward trial and listed below is actually the code for the demonstration.\nAbout.\nvue-rewards permits you include micro-interactions to your application, and also rewards customers along with the storm of confetti, emoji or balloons in few seconds.\nFiring confetti around the webpage may look like a doubtful tip, however keep in mind that gratifying users for their actions is certainly not.\nIf a substantial cloud of smiling emoji doesn't accommodate your use effectively, choose changing the physics config to create it even more refined.\nYou can easily find out more when it come to micro-interactions in my article-- https:\/\/www.thedevelobear.com\/post\/microinteractions\/.\nInstallation.\npnpm set up vue-rewards.\nor even.\nanecdote incorporate vue-rewards.\nor.\nnpm put in vue-rewards.\nIf you prepare to use this with the Options API then you will need to add the observing code to your main.js (or you might discover the plugin registration in plugins\/index. js):.\nbring in createApp coming from \"vue\".\nbring in App coming from \".\/ App.vue\".\nbring in VueRewards coming from \"vue-rewards\".\n\/\/ your various other plugins will be actually imported below.\n\nconst application = createApp( App).\n\n\/\/ This is the almost all.\napp.use( VueRewards).\n\napp.mount(\" #app\").\nUtilization.\nTo use the perks, you'll need to have to provide a factor that will certainly come to be the origin of the animation. This component needs to have to have an i.d. that matches the one utilized - it could be throughout the DOM just as long as the IDs match.\nYou can place the factor inside a switch, facility it as well as skyrocket from the button.\nYou can put it in addition to the viewport with position: \"repaired\" and alter the angle to 270, to shoot downwards.\nMake an effort, practice, have a blast!\nComputer animation particles are actually set to setting: 'repaired' through nonpayment, however this could be transformed with a config object.\nYou can use this package deal in both the make-up API as well as the alternatives API.\nMaking Use Of the Composition API.\n\n\n\nAllow's commemorate!\n\nClick me!\n\n\nMaking Use Of the Options API.\nGiven that we registered the plugin earlier our company today have access to the $perks method in our components. $reward coincides as useReward. To receive the like above our team perform:.\n\nAllow's commemorate!\n\nHit me!\n\n\n\n\nProps &amp config.\nuseReward\/$ benefit params:.\ntitle.\nstyle.\nclassification.\nneeded.\nnonpayment.\ni.d..\ncord.\nAn one-of-a-kind id of the factor you wish to fire coming from.\nyes.\n\nstyle.\nstring.\n' confetti'.\n' balloons'.\n'em oji'.\nof course.\n' confetti'.\nconfig.\nthings.\nan arrangement object explained listed below.\nno.\nobserve listed below.\nConfetti config things:.\ntitle.\ntype.\nclassification.\ndefault.\nlife time.\nnumber.\nopportunity of life.\n200.\nangle.\nnumber.\nfirst instructions of particles in degrees.\n90.\ndegeneration.\nnumber.\nthe amount of the speed decreases along with each structure.\n0.94.\nspreading.\nvariety.\nspread of fragments in levels.\n45.\nstartVelocity.\namount.\ninitial rate of fragments.\n35.\nelementCount.\namount.\nbits amount.\nFifty.\nelementSize.\nnumber.\nbit size in px.\n8.\nzIndex.\nvariety.\nz-index of bits.\n0\nplacement.\nstrand.\none of CSSProperties [' placement'] - e.g. \"complete\".\n\" taken care of\".\ncolors.\nstring [] A collection of different colors used when creating confetti.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'#F 5F770'] onAnimationComplete.\n() =&gt void.\nA functionality that works when computer animation completes.\nboundless.\nBalloons config object:.\nlabel.\nkind.\ndescription.\nnonpayment.\nlife-time.\nnumber.\nopportunity of lifestyle.\n600.\nposition.\nvariety.\ninitial instructions of balloons in degrees.\n90.\ndegeneration.\nnumber.\nthe amount of the velocity lowers along with each frame.\n0.999.\nspreading.\nvariety.\nescalate of balloons in levels.\n50.\nstartVelocity.\nvariety.\npreliminary speed of the balloons.\n3.\nelementCount.\nvariety.\nballoons amount.\n10.\nelementSize.\namount.\nballoons dimension in px.\nTwenty.\nzIndex.\namount.\nz-index of balloons.\n0\nposture.\nstrand.\nsome of CSSProperties [' placement'] - e.g. \"complete\".\n\" repaired\".\ncolours.\ncord [] A range of different colors used when creating balloons.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'

F 5F770'] onAnimationComplete.() =&gt space.A function that functions when computer animation completes.boundless.Emoji config item:.name.style.classification.nonpayment.life time.amount.time of life.200.angle.amount.first instructions of emoji in levels.90.degeneration.variety.just how much the velocity minimizes with each frame.0.94.spread.number.spread of emoji in levels.Forty five.startVelocity.number.preliminary speed of emoji.35.elementCount.number.emoji quantity.20.elementSize.number.emoji dimension in px.25.zIndex.amount.z-index of emoji.0setting.strand.one of CSSProperties [' placement'] - e.g. "absolute"." taken care of".emoji.strand [] An assortment of emoji to shoot.onAnimationComplete.() =&gt space.A function that functions when computer animation completes.boundless.